摘要

Computer network technology and distributed information processing technology have been developing rapidly. In the meantime, deregulation is starting and will be spreading in the electric power industry in Japan. Consequently, customers request low cost power supply and high quality services from the power suppliers. Corresponding to these requirements caused by deregulation, the authors developed a prototype power systems information delivering system supplying useful power systems information such as power failures. The prototype system was developed based on SCOPE (system configuration of power control system) architecture that we had already proposed. SCOPE architecture assures flexibility and scalability for power systems. The prototype system consists of an application layer based on a Web browser, an information model layer which reflects the power systems behavior and a distributed object management layer using CORBA and OS/Network layer. In this paper, we introduce the concept, functions, implementation of the prototype system and its evaluation results.
